Prepping for the Job: What Happens Before Paint Goes On
The first step in an interior painting project usually starts with a walkthrough. This lets everyone be on the same page about which rooms are being painted, what colors are being used, and if there are any issues to look out for. It is a great chance to ask questions or talk through concerns before the work begins.
Next, your space gets protected. That often means moving light furniture or covering it so nothing gets splattered. Floors are covered too, and switch plates or wall hangings are handled with care.
The final prep step is getting the walls ready. That includes:
- Cleaning spots where grime or dust could mess up the paint
- Filling in small holes or dings
- Light sanding to smooth the surface for a clean finish
This early work is not glamorous, but it is what helps the paint look smooth and last longer.

What the Painting Process Looks Like
Once the space is prepped, painting begins. Rooms are usually done in stages, starting at the ceiling, then moving down the walls, and finishing with trim. This keeps edges clean and the job organized.
You might notice a little bit of smell or noise during the project, especially early on. Paint does have a scent, though it fades quickly once dry. Most work happens during the day so you are not interrupted at night, and schedules are planned with your comfort in mind.
During the job, you might see:
- One or two people working quietly and steadily
- A mix of ladders, drop cloths, and paint cans in use (all neatly placed)
- Sections being painted while others dry
If your house is being painted room by room, you can usually still live there comfortably while work is happening.
Whole-house painting projects may be broken up into sections so you are not left without access to key spaces for long.
How Long It Takes and What Affects the Timeline
One of the most common questions is how long interior painting takes. The answer depends on a few simple things.
Smaller rooms can sometimes be finished in a single day. Larger rooms with high ceilings or lots of trim might take more time. Drying between coats matters too, since rushing that part can ruin the final look.
Timeline can be impacted by:
- How many rooms are being painted
- How much prep work is needed before painting starts
- The number of coats (usually two, sometimes more)

What to Expect After the Job Is Done
The end of the job matters just as much as the beginning. Once the last coat is dry, it is time for touch-ups. Painters walk the space to check that no spots were missed and everything looks just right.
Cleanup comes next. Drop cloths are packed up, tape is removed, floors get swept or vacuumed, and furniture is put back in place. The goal is for you to walk into each room and feel like it is yours again, only brighter and refreshed.
After cleanup is finished, you can expect:
- Fresh walls with smooth, even color
- Rooms that feel newer and more inviting with nothing but new paint
- A clean space with a light, fresh scent that does not linger harshly
